Dian Sastrowardoyo Bio

Dian Paramita Sastrowardoyo, also known as Dian Sastrowardoyo or Dian Sastro, is an Indonesian actress and model who was born on March 16, 1982, in Jakarta. In 1996, she debuted as the cover girl of Gadis, a popular teen magazine in Indonesia. She played Daya in “Pasir Berbisik”, which was a critical success and earned her numerous awards. She was widely recognized for her performance as Cinta in the 2002 romantic film Ada Apa Dengan Cinta?, for which she received the Citra Award for Best Actress. She returned to the role 14 years later in the sequel. In 2002, she won the Best Actress award at the Deauville Asian Film Festival for her performance in Pasir Berbisik. Sastrowardoyo is one of Indonesia's most successful actresses. Since 2010, she has been the face of L'Oréal Paris Indonesia. Did she reprise her role as the titular character in Ada Apa Dengan Cinta? 2, the sequel to Ada Apa Dengan Cinta?, opposite actor Nicholas Saputra, in 2016. Since then, she has established herself as one of Indonesia's most bankable actresses, appearing in films such as “Banyu Biru”, “Ungu Violet”, and “Belahan Jiwa”, as well as international productions such as “Malaysia's Puteri Gunung Ledang”.
